It's a bit like Minecraft, but better in my opinion becuase unlike in Minecraft you have an actual goal. You start out empty-handed and work your way towards the better weapons and armors so you can kill bosses and get even better stuff. You build house(s) where different NPC's move in. The NPC's all sell different stuff which you can use, for example the arms dealer sells different kinds of weapons and ammo. Great game overall, and well worth the money!
Brilliant game in every aspect. The game has a voice that narrates everything you do which really sets it apart from other games in the same genre. It's very effective and makes the game more enjoyable. The gameplay is a mix of action and RPG with lots of different weapons that you can upgrade and "Secret skills" that you can learn. Bastion is a very challenging game, especially if you activate the different "Idols" which makes enemies tougher but also gives you more XP and money. Overall, Bastion is a great game and a must-buy in my opinion!
